From the names of the Qur'ān is Al-Furqān (the Criterion). It is called this because it separates and distinguishes good from evil, truth from falsehood, people of good from people of evil, guidance from misguidance, the right path from the wrong path, and al-halāl from al-harām.

The reasons that lead to the prevalence of religious innovation: 1. Ignorance in regards to the religious laws and rulings 2. The following of desires 3. Bigotry to opinions and personalities 4. Resemblance of the unbelievers and imitation of them in their beliefs and customs

An-Nawawi: ‘Know that the excellence of zikr is not confined to tasbīh, tahlīl, tahmīd and takbīr and their likes. Rather anyone performing a deed for Allāh, the Most High, in obedience to Him then he is remembering Allāh, the Most High.'
